GrammarJLPT N5
... years old
Counter

Definitions

  1. 1. ... years old
  2. 2. age (of) ...
This suffix is attached to a number to express a person's age, equivalent to "years old" in English. It is used universally in Japanese regardless of the person's age, and learners should practice it alongside number vocabulary.
